At 11:20 AM -0800 2005-02-15, scot condry wrote:

>  Hello.  I recently upgraded from Fedora 2 to Fedora 3 (upgrade, not
>  a fresh install).  Everything is working OK except when I go to my
>  mailman web page it says there are not lists configured.  They are
>  not working as well (as in if you send an email to the list it is
>  nto being delivered).  Can anyoen help me migrate my lists?

	When you did the upgrade, it probably wiped out your apache 
configuration file, as well as all the stuff that had been done to 
your MTA configuration to enable the mailing lists.

	If you've got a backup, you may be able to restore the affected 
files.  If not, you're going to have a fair amount of work ahead of 
you to re-create these files.


	Moral of the story: Don't blindly apply any upgrade from anyone, 
anywhere.  Make sure you have a good backup before you apply any 
upgrade, and make sure you know what the upgrade is going to do.
